Ordinals
beta
Sat 1873823341751456
decimal
688117.216751456
degree
0°58117′661″216751456‴
percentile
89.22968303869821%
name
aoqbbvdrxbl
cycle
0
epoch
3
period
341
block
688117
offset
216751456
timestamp
2021-06-18 22:44:10 UTC
rarity
common
prev
next